Topical clofibrate (0.25%w/w) is available through Dr. Fukaya’s web shop.



 Topical clofibrate is a non-steroidal ointment but can suppress mild eczema without rebound phenomenon. The anti-inflammatory effect is weaker than topical steroids.  It can be used individually or simultaneously with the Dr Fukaya’s skin repair lotion (hyaluronan lotion of 100,000 dalton ). As the hyaluronan lotion only prevents skin atropy due to steroids or helps to recover from it and doesn’t work as an anti-inflammatory agent, combination therapy of the lotion and topical clofibrate is recommended for better results to eczema-sufferers.

 Topical clofibrate is an ointment easy to be prepared by any physician or pharmacist. The materials needed are clofibrate capsules which is widely available, cheap and old medication for hyperlipidemia and white petrolatum as a base ointment. The base ointment is not limited to white petrolatum. You can mix clofibrate to anything you prefer or whatever your skin can tolerate. Even water can be used as a base (oil in water emulsion).

 The above photo shows aspiration of clofibrate by a medical syringe and needles from the capsule. Clofibrate is oily transparent liquid and the specific gravity is 1.14. One capsule contains 250mg (0.21ml).



 By aspiration from about 7 capsules, one can collect about 1.1ml of clofibrate. It weighs 1.25grams and is just the amount for 0.25%w/w in 500 gram base.

 White petrolatum is a solid material at the room temperature.

  The melting point of white petrolatum is about 38-60℃. So it becomes liquid completely at the temperature of 70℃. One can add the clofibrate to the white petrolatum liquid and mix them to make uniform.

  After cooling, it returns to solid ointment again and the clofibrate ointment (0.25%w/w) is prepared.

 What is the mechanism of clofibrate as an anti-inflammatory agent? How does it work? It is a little complicated. Clofibrate is one of PPAR alpha ligands. PPAR alpha activates NFkappaB which stimulates to produce TSLP in keratinocytes. The below figure shows the vicious cycle in atopic dermatitis which was elucidated by Matsuoka et al in 2012 (J Clin Invest. 2012 Jul 2;122(7):2590-600). The PPAR alpha ligand such as clofibrate works at the point of red arrow and terminates the vicious cycle.
  There is an interesting report about topical PPAR ligands. Hatano et al reported that a kind of topical PPAR alpha ligand, which had been revealed to suppress mild eczema but have not enough power to suppress severe eczema, can suppress experimental rebound phenomenon after continuous topical steroid use in mice. In the experiment, mice were treated to express eczema by some allergen artificially on the skin, followed by topical steroids application and then continued to be applied topical steroids in one group and replaced to topical PPAR alpha ligands in the other group. The former group developed rebound while the latter didn’t (J Invest Dermatol. 2011 Sep;131(9):1845-52).  


The figure is referred from Hatano’s article above mentioned.

 So if topical steroids therapy is changed to topical PPAR alpha ligand therapy on the way the eczema subsides, sufferers are estimated to have less risk to develop rebound phenomenon. Moreover, as topical PPAR alpha ligands themselves have weak anti-inflammatory effect, eczema sufferers may try to use them as the first choice before using steroids.

 I was very much interested in Hatano’s paper and made up my mind to confirm the utility of topical clofibrate by myself two years ago. So I announced my idea through internet in Japanese and collected 20 patients who would participate in my study. They were divided into two groups double-blindly and the effects were compared between the topical clofibrate applied group and placebo group. The efficacy of objective and subjective symptoms was confirmed significantly and TARC in the clofibrate group also decreased significantly while placebo group not. The whole results of the study was made up to an article and published in the Journal of Drugs in Dermatology. 2014 Mar;13(3).

Ophthalmological complications

“You don’t need to visit any dermatologist including me, but you should visit an ophthalmologist periodically.” That was my habitual saying to patients with atopic dermatitis.

 There are several ophthalmological complications in atopic dermatitis. Well, I will make a question about it.

 You should clear the exam before treating your atopic dermatitis by yourself. Never feel easy about ophthalmological complications only because you are seeing some dermatologist. They see only your skin and never see your eyes.

 Which is the ophthalmological complication in atopic dermatitis?

a.cataract  b.retinal detachment  c.conjunctivitis d.keratoconus e.glaucoma

1.a  2.a,b  3.a,b,c,d  4.all 5.none

  Atopic cataract occurs suddenly. Though steroids can induce cataract, atopic cataract occurs regardless of steroid therapy. There were patients with atopic cataract several decades ago when steroids were not yet invented.

 Cataract has a tendency to develop a while after severe dermatitis has subsided. Some dermatologists criticize TSW insisting that TSW is the cause of cataract. But it is a ridiculous theory because the cause of TSW (A) is topical steroids. Bad dermatologists neglect their duty to give information about ophthalmological complication before the patients develop cataract and blame their TSW after the development of cataract. 

 When cataract is developed, the patient’s pupil becomes cloudy. It occurs one day and progresses in a few days. It is just like you have a drip of milk in your eye. Fortunately, cataract can be treated by operation. You can recover eyesight. Ophthalmologists might use eye drops of topical steroids for the purpose of conditioning the situations around the operation. You should not be so nervous but you can request of the ophthalmologist to refrain from using it if you never like to use it. Usually ophthalmologists are not so stubborn about topical steroids and accept your request.

 Anyway, your cataract should be operated not only because you could recover eyesight but also because it will help an early identification of retinal detachment.

 Retinal detachment in atopic dermatitis starts in the peripheral parts of the retina. It is the part of difficulty in examination. If there were untreated cataract, ophthalmologists couldn’t check the part.

 If the retinal detachment is identified early when it is small, laser therapy can stop the progression. So it is very important to find out as early as possible.

 Retinal detachment is considered to be caused by the repeated or frequent banging to the skin around the eyes. Mechanical vibration is an inducement. So we dermatologists often warn patients not to bang around the eyes but the stress of the patients become increased by the warning itself and they bang or spank more and more. Nobody seems to be able to stop it. So I recommend patients to visit an ophthalmologist at least. The damage would become the least by examining the retina periodically.

 Conjunctivitis is a symptom of allergy. Sometimes the cornea is also damaged mechanically because of the mucosal roughness of the eyelid side of the conjunctiva. Keratoconus is completely a complication of atopic dermatitis itself. The eyesight of the patient with keratoconus can be corrected by the contact lens.

 Glaucoma is the side effect of steroids or antihistamines if the ocular tension decreases by stopping those drugs. Glaucoma is never a complication of atopic dermatitis. So the answer of the above question is 3.

A report about a biological product for patients with atopic dermatitis.

 Have you heard of the medicine called a biological product? It is a practical application of the monoclonal antibody.
 There are various biological products available nowadays. Among them Xolair (Omalizumab) is the most promising for atopic dermatitis at present.


 Xolair was studied as a medicine for asthma. Patients with asthma often suffer from atopic dermatitis also. Some patients with asthma to whom Xolair was administered also improved their eczema. So doctors started to study the efficacy of the medicine for atopic dermatitis. Some reported Xolair was useful while the others reported not effective. There was no double blinded case-control study. The below report is the first double blinded case-control study about Xolair for atopic dermatitis though the population is small.

Immunologic Effects of Omalizumab in Children with Severe Refractory Atopic Dermatitis: A Randomized, Placebo-Controlled Clinical Trial. Iyengar SR,et al. Int Arch Allergy Immunol. 2013 Jun 27;162(1):89-93  

 The number of patients was 8 at the age of 4-22. They were divided to two groups of placebo and Omalizumab administration.
 They were all refractory patients (“All patients had severe AD that had failed standard therapy.”). Whole the treatment was discontinued one week before the first administration of the placebo or Omalizumab. The agent was administered by subcutaneous injection and the dosage of Omalizumab was 150-375mg every time. The frequency was every 2-4 weeks and the duration of treatment was 22 weeks.

 Total IgE, Free IgE, TARC and SCORAD values are picked up from the results of the article as the following table. How do you read the numerals?


 Omalizumab is an antibody to IgE. It binds to the patient’s IgE and inactivates it. The free IgE decreaseed and Th2 system also became inactivated.
 However, about the SCORAD which indicate the clinical severity of atopic dermatitis, the values decreased in both the placebo and Omalizumab groups. How should we understand the result?

 I consider there is a possibility that the placebo patients improved  by topical steroid withdrawal(TSW) for 22 weeks.

 In the article, the authors didn’t mention the result of the statistical analysis. So I did the matched Student’s t test to their results. The P value were as the following.
 

  At the 0.05% of the significance level, the placebo group improved while Omalizumab group didn’t improve.

 The author’s comment is as the following.
“The high rate of response to placebo has been well documented in these types of studies and, had any of the above published studies examining the clinical effects of anti-IgE included a placebo arm, a similar rate of response may have been seen.”

 Wait for a while. The phrase is likely to be skipped just carelessly but you ( the author) mentioned the patients were all refractory to the usual standard therapy, weren’t they? You admit such patients improved by the placebo treatment for 22 weeks and it is often the case with that kind of studies?

 Yes, atopic dermatitis has a tendency of natural healing. But the enrolled patients were “All patients had severe AD that had failed standard therapy.” I suppose you should not have forecasted their natural improvement before the study.

 The price of Xolair is about USD 350 per 75mg. It costs about USD 4200-21000 for 22 week treatment.

The bankrupt of the regulation of cortisol level in the skin tissue might be the essence of TSA.

Recently it has been revealed that epidermal cells produce cortisol (corticosteroid) by themselves. Topical steroid addiction (TSA) is considered to be related with the skin atrophy which causes the barrier dysfunction. The bankrupt of the regulation of cortisol concentration in the skin tissue might be its ground.

 The concentration of cortisol in the skin tissue is kept lower than in the blood.
 According to the following article about thermal injured patients, for example, plasma total cortisol took the value of 8.8μg/dl, free (protein unbound) cortisol 1.7μg/dl and tissue (skin) cortisol 0.74μg/dl.

 Measurement of tissue cortisol levels in patients with severe burns: a preliminary investigation.Cohen J et al, Crit Care. 2009;13(6):R189. Epub 2009 Nov 27.
   
 In healthy subjects as a control, the tissue cortisol was 0.20μg/dl. Only a fraction of the concentration in the blood is detected in the normal skin tissue outside the blood vessels and the value increases once inflammation such as burn occurs.

  By the way, epidermal cells, hair follicular cells and fibroblasts in the dermis can produce cortisol by themselves. What is more interesting is that the production of cortisol by those cells is amplified by the skin tissue cortisol. There is a positive feedback mechanism.


On the other hand, there is  also an enzyme that inactivates cortisol in the sweat gland. The concentration of cortisol in the skin tissue is controlled by those factors. The following figure is what is summarized.

11βHSD1 is an enzyme that converts cortisone (inactive steroid) to cortisol (active steroid) while 11βHSD2 is an enzyme that converts the latter to the former.
 What is the meaning of the positive feedback mechanism of cortisol production? It must be for the purpose of increasing the skin tissue concentration of cortisol rapidly in case of any inflammation such as burn occurs.

 If topical steroids are applied to the skin, epidermal cells or fibroblasts react to TS and produce cortisol. The increased cortisol effects to the cells themselves and suppress their own proliferation. In case of systemic steroids such as oral steroids, the effect to the skin tissue concentration is not so much because blood vessels regulate cortisol not to transfer too much to the skin tissue.

  Now you can understand how abnormal the situation of continuous use of topical steroids to the skin is. Physiologically the concentration of cortisol in the skin tissue is kept considerably low. Topical steroids violate the controlled situation.

 After stopping topical steroids, the epidermis becomes thicker than before TS application temporarily. It means the skin tissue lacks enough steroids temporarily.

 
1A:Before application of TS, 1B: thin epidermis after TS application, 1C 1D 1E: temporarily thickened epidermis after discontinuance of TS
(Morphologic Investigations on the Rebound Phenomenon After Corticosteroid Induced Atrophy in Human Skin. Zheng P, et al. J Invest Dermatol 82: 345-352, 1984)
 
 The fact that epidermis becomes thick means that the steroid deficiency has occurred. But what is the mechanism of the deficiency? There must have been too much steroids.
 
  One of the possible mechanism is as the following.

  11βHSD1/2 balance, which is 11βHSD1 dominant in the epidermal cells normally, changes to become11βHSD2 dominant after considerable dose of TS application.

 After discontinuance of TS, the skin tissue cortisol becomes low temporarily. Inactive form of steroid (cortisone ) is accumulated within the cell. After 11βHSD1 reactivation, skin tissue cortisol will be produced but from the accumulated cortisone. It never is a normal condition. The gene coding cortisol will not be up-regulated under such a condition and various proteins which are related to the gene will not  also be produced. So the skin remains fragile and the barrier dysfunction continues.

 It is only a hypothesis. However the temporarily deficiency of steroids after discontinuance must be explained in any way.  
 
 The below figure shows 11βHSD1/2 expression of the normal skin (brown means 11βHSD) . 11βHSD1 is expressed on the whole cells of epidermis while 11βHSD2 is expressed only on the outer layer. Obviously there is a regulated balance of 11βHSD1/2 in the normal conditions.
 (Keratinocytes synthesize and activate cortisol.Cirillo et al.J Cell Biochem. 2011 Jun;112(6):1499-505)

 The concentration of cortisol in the skin tissue is kept low basically and the constituent cells produce or inactivate cortisol according to the inflammatory status. Topical steroids application violates its harmony and constituent cells become instable after TS application. I consider it might be the essence of TSA existing as the ground of the barrier dysfunction caused by TS.

Do topical steroids prolong atopic dermatitis?

Apart from the problem of TSA/TSW, there exists another important problem which most of the patients are anxious about.
 
“If the population of patients with TSA is 10 or 20% as Dr. Fukaya mentions, why is the number of patients with atopic dermatitis increasing? Is there any possibility that TCS application prolongs AD and postpones the natural healing?”
 
 In fact, the number of patients with AD has been increasing after TCS was produced and came onto the market more than half a century ago . There is no other disease that a population of the patients increased after a medicine for the disease had been produced.
 
 One Japanese researcher presented an interesting article in 2010 about experiments using AD model mice. Mice treated with a kind of chemicals on the skin repeatedly develop AD like dermatitis. He compared the skin (ear) thickness and scratching behavior of TS treated group and non-treated group. The result revealed TS improve the skin thickness but argument the frequency of scratching behavior.The results were the same when he changed mice strain, chemicals or the kinds of TS.
 
Repeated topical application of glucocorticoids augments irritant chemical-triggered scratching in mice. Fujii Y et.al. Arch Dermatol Res. 2010 Nov;302(9):645-52.

 
The above figure is from Fujii’s article. TPA is a kind of chemical which causes eczema. The white bar is of mice not treated with TS and the black bar is of TS-treated. TS suppress the eczema (ear swelling) but increase scratching frequency.
 
Then, he measured the concentrations of the substanceP and NGF(nerve growth factor) of the skin lesion which are both associated with itch sensation of the skin.  Both were increased in the TS-treated lesion than non-treated lesion.
 
To explain instinctively for easy understanding, repeated stimulation by antigens causing eczema which subside apparently by application of TS, also cause decreased threshold of scratching. Inflammation that TS suppress is substantially a protection against extrinsic stimuli. After the suppression by TS, another mechanism of protection must start if the stimulus doesn't disappear. It is the mechanical protection by scratching behavior.
 
Some patients would agree in the result of experiments from their own experience. The itching just before the withdrawal when those patients felt ineffectiveness to TS seems to be very offensive and strange. The itching stays very inward and they often tell the itching after TSW is also itching but very different from that of before withdrawal. The latter is far better than the former.
 
The above mentioned Japanese researcher is Fujii in his name and he belongs to Astellas pharma Inc. which is the manufacturer and provider of Protopic ointment.
 
As I have already written, the history of Protopic (or Elidel in Europe) is dramatic. In around 2000, Protopic appeared like a savior of the TSA problem. We dermatologists all thought that TSA or rosacea-like dermatitis due to TS at least in the face would disappear in several years. But several cases were reported that Protopic also caused rosacea. All people concerned were shocked and thought “ What is the merit of Protopic if it also causes rosacea?” I imagine Fujii was also one of them. By the way,there was another preceding report by other researchers that Protopic was superior to TS in the suppression of scratching behavior.
 
 Inhibition of scratching behavior associated with allergic dermatitis in mice by tacrolimus, but not by dexamethasone. Inagaki N et al. Eur J Pharmacol. 2006 Sep 28;546(1-3):189-96.
 
 Fujii might have been interested in it and retest it. The results were more than he expected. He has revealed not only the superiority of Protopic to TS but also the negative aspect of TS about the prolongation of the disease. Fujii concluded the end of the article like the following.
 
In summary, this study is the first to show the potential of topical glucocorticoids to augment itch sensation, not via the augmentation of inflammation. This phenomenon might result   from   the augmentation of   SP   and   NGF   production, along   with   nerve  fiber   extension,   at   the   application   site.
Given the profound impact of scratching on skin inflammation, these findings might explain the etiology of the exacerbation   of   atopic   dermatitis   and   other   dermatitises, which occurs after long-term or inappropriate use of topical glucocorticoids.

About Strong Neo-Minophagen C(SNMC)

Note; This article is a supplementation to the comment in the following article.
[Paradoxical idea of systemic steroids use for withdrawal from topical steroids]
http://mototsugufukaya.blogspot.jp/2013/06/paradoxical-idea-of-systemic-steroids.html
 
Strong Neo-Minophagen C(SNMC) is an old medicine made in Japan. It is administered only by intravenous injection.

The active ingredient is glycyrrhetinic acid, a constituent of liquorice.


The efficacy of Chinese herbs containing liquorice is thought to be due to glycyrrhetinic acid at least partially.

Some doctors in Japan prefer SNMC for suppressing rebound after TSW. The mechanism is considered as 11 beta-OHSD suppression.  11 beta-OHSD is an enzyme  which changes cortisol to cortisone: inactive form of cortisol.



The below graph is from Greaves’s article. The horizontal axis is the concentration of medicines and longitudinal axis is human skin branching due to topical steroids.

Beclomethasone dipropionate and hydrocortisone acetate are both TC and the former is stronger than the latter. The data tells the effect of hydorocortisone acetate is amplified by the addition of glycyrrhetinic acid.

Potentiation of hydrocortisone activity in skin by glycerrhetinic acid. Greaves MW. Lancet. 1990 Oct 6;336(8719):876.

Doctors using SNMC for the rebound seem to consider it is safe because it is not an administration of extrinsic steroids. However, it is very near to the weak systemic steroids injection in fact.

I also have experience of this method. It was rather weak and didn’t become popular among my patients. Systemic steroids injection is more recommendable than SNMC from my thinking but it is certain that SNMC is an alternative method anyway. I have never heard or read that SNMC caused rebound.
